Class calendar integration ensures assignments automatically appear in Google Calendar for time management. A teacher can create multiple classes, customizing sections, subject periods, and co-teachers with a few clicks.
Communication and Stream Management The Class Stream functions as a classroom homepage where teachers post announcements, resources, and questions to spark discussion. Monitoring Progress and Academic Integrity Teachers track engagement through the Classwork page, where color-coded icons indicate submission status and return dates.

Educators can open assignments directly in Docs, Slides, or Sheets to add inline comments, suggest edits, or insert audio feedback using extensions. Organizing Materials and Topics Inside the class stream, teachers organize content using Topics, which act like digital folders for units, weeks, or skill areas.
